CHARLESTON LAKE - BACKPACKING WEEKEND


This will be an easy backpacking weekend with the emphasis on watching for wildlife and enjoying the scenery. Charleston Lake Provincial Park is home to a rich diversity of plant and animal species, mostly due to the unusual mix of Canadian Shield geology in a southern location and warmer climate.

The total backpacking loop is only about 10km but we may take a few side trips along the way. Time permitting we will also do a day hike along some of the Park's interior trails. Dogs are welcome but must be on a leash.

I've booked Bob's Cove, which has a trail leading down to Slim Bay, home to a nesting site for loons. We will also take some time to look for pitch pine - a very rare species of pine, as well as aboriginal rock paintings and caves. The park is also home to the black rock snake - a harmless boa constrictor as well as red-shouldered hawks and southern flying squirrels, as well as beavers, white-tailed deer, fishers and mink.

Note: this is not a car camping weekend. Participants should own or be prepared to borrow/rent basic lightweight gear, including: layered clothing for hiking and at camp, rain gear, gaiters, extra socks, hiking boots, sleeping bag and sleeping mat, back pack, cooking pot/lid/cup/bowl/spoon, water filter/tablets, whistle, basic first aid kit, sunscreen, bug repellent and headlamp. There are patches of poison ivy throughout the park. Where possible, gear such as tents and stoves will be shared.
